Transaction 90016a17784cfa87652d352429224089a050f46eab38ebe75c35f39ccf7e3b77
1 Input
2 Outputs
- 90016a17784cfa87652d352429224089a050f46eab38ebe75c35f39ccf7e3b77:0
- 90016a17784cfa87652d352429224089a050f46eab38ebe75c35f39ccf7e3b77:1
value 400000
address 1DC9Rb36YuEfZmn7XnN2knx1YKUsdvxs1
value 1018331
address 19CiFZYwcB8CzFUuSZaFbpXMcbTgix32pj